What are the Best Roofing Materials for New Brunswick?

New Brunswick's climate presents unique challenges for roofing. The region experiences significant snowfall in winter and periods of intense rainfall in the spring and summer. Therefore, choosing a durable and weather-resistant material is paramount. Popular choices include:

  • Asphalt Shingles: These remain a cost-effective and widely available option. Their lifespan typically ranges from 15 to 30 years depending on the quality and installation. However, they're susceptible to damage from heavy snow and ice. Choosing architectural shingles, which offer superior durability and wind resistance, is often advisable in New Brunswick's climate.

  • Metal Roofing: Metal roofs (aluminum, steel, or copper) are exceptionally durable, long-lasting (50+ years), and resistant to harsh weather conditions. They're also energy-efficient, reflecting sunlight and reducing cooling costs. While initially more expensive than asphalt shingles, their longevity makes them a worthwhile investment.

  • Cedar Shakes: These offer a rustic aesthetic, but require more maintenance than other options and are more susceptible to rot and insect damage if not properly treated. They may not be the most practical choice for New Brunswick's climate unless meticulously maintained.

What are Common Roofing Repair Needs in New Brunswick?

Several issues frequently affect roofs in New Brunswick:

  • Ice Dams: These form when melting snow refreezes at the edge of the roof, causing water to back up under the shingles. This can lead to significant damage, including leaks and structural issues. Proper attic ventilation is essential to prevent ice dams.

  • Leaks: Leaks can stem from various sources, including damaged shingles, flashing issues around chimneys and vents, or deteriorated roofing underlayment. Addressing leaks promptly is crucial to prevent further damage to your home's structure.

  • Shingle Damage: Strong winds, heavy snow, and hail can all cause damage to asphalt shingles, leading to cracking, curling, and missing shingles. Regular inspections are recommended to identify and address damage before it becomes severe.

How Much Does Roof Repair and Installation Cost in New Brunswick?

The cost of roofing repair and installation in New Brunswick varies widely depending on several factors:

  • Roof size and complexity: Larger and more complex roofs naturally require more materials and labor.

  • Chosen roofing material: Metal roofing is generally more expensive than asphalt shingles.

  • Labor costs: Labor rates vary among contractors.

  • Existing roof condition: Significant repairs or tear-offs can increase costs.

Obtaining multiple quotes from reputable contractors is crucial to securing a fair price.

How Long Does Roof Installation Take in New Brunswick?

The duration of a roof installation project depends on several factors, including the roof size, complexity, and weather conditions. A small roof replacement might take a few days, while a larger or more complex project could take a week or more. Experienced contractors will provide an estimated timeline during the initial consultation.

What Questions Should I Ask a New Brunswick Roofing Contractor?

Before hiring a contractor, it's crucial to ask clarifying questions, including:

  • Licensing and insurance: Ensure they hold the necessary licenses and insurance.

  • Experience and references: Inquire about their experience with similar projects and ask for references.

  • Detailed quote: Request a detailed, itemized quote that includes all materials, labor costs, and any potential extra expenses.

  • Warranty: Understand the warranty offered on materials and workmanship.

  • Timeline: Discuss the anticipated start and completion dates.

How Do I Find a Reputable Roofing Contractor in New Brunswick?

Finding a reliable contractor requires thorough research:

  • Online reviews: Check online review sites for customer feedback and ratings.

  • Recommendations: Ask friends, family, and neighbors for recommendations.

  • Local associations: Contact local home builder associations or contractor associations for referrals.

  • Check licensing: Verify the contractor's license and insurance with the relevant authorities.
